I have V15 type IV Cartridge purchased some 25 years back. Not used for more than 20 years now.
Now i am in USA. Hence thought of 2 things. 1) To buy generic stylus for V15 type IV ( copy cartridge) or 2) Buy new N97XE Cartridge with new spare original needles. I hv some 500 LP's & 300 EP's with me in total. Mostly in brand new condition. wish to convert them. I need advice/guidance in the matter. |

N97XE is not really that good. Design wise and quality wise. AT440MLa sounds way better once it is broken in.
Getting aftermarket for V15 - the only decent option here would be stylus from JICO. But even here I think JICO products are overrated too. They don't even have technical specs for the products they sell. |
